A Kenny Omega match has been announced for this week’s (November 1) episode of AEW Dynamite.

On last week’s Collision show, Kenny Omega took part in an incredible AEW World Championship bout against MJF, ultimately coming up short in his attempt to regain the title and stop MJF from breaking his record as the longest reigning AEW World Champion.

Following the show, we now know the next move for Kenny Omega following the match, and it’s a reunion with Chris Jericho.

Tony Khan has now announced that Jericho and Omega will once again team up, taking on 2point0’s Matt Menard and Angelo Parker at the request of Don Callis.

Menard and Parker were both former members of the Jericho Appreciation Society, with the group dissolving following Jericho’s babyface turn back in August.

MJF will also be back in action on the show, when he teams with three chosen partners to take on Bullet Club Gold.

An AEW International Championship match between Orange Cassidy and Claudio Castagnoli is also set for the show.
